Explain the Request/Response Interface
Many issues are involved in providing a procedural interface for client functions to interact with server components. First off, since my example uses one function as a pathway, each specific request of the server must be made through arguments passed to the interface procedure called CSInterface().
Usually, the first argument to the procedure will tell the CSInterface() which server procedure is to be executed, and the CSInterface() code is to perform its duties accordingly.
